WebNov 22, 2024 · Probiotics are likely safe for most people. Probiotic side effects are generally few, mild and temporary. Side effects are usually digestive in nature, such as gas or bloating. However, probiotics may cause problems for people with certain medical conditions, such as a weakened immune system. WebSep 6, 2024 · Probiotics are mostly useless and can actually hurt you.
